This thing is seriously well built! For anyone that cares, here is a little step by step.
Sealed front! No dust getting in- good :) No access to internals from front- bad :(

Output board on top left. All channels, outputs and everything else unpluggable i presume for servicing or replacement. All labelled too so you know exactly what is what.

See any fuses? Hidden in there somewhere....little buggers.

After using a spanner(!) to remove the output jacks and the attached board, finally get to the two blown fuses.
Both had blown, as the seller had said. No other signs of tampering or damage whatsoever.
Replaced them with 2 500mA fuses and put it all back together.
